Timezone in Grendon Underwood
Grendon Underwood is situated in the Europe/London timezone, which operates on a UTC offset of +0 during standard time. This means that when it is noon in Coordinated Universal Time, it is 12:00 PM in Grendon Underwood. However, the area observes daylight saving time, shifting the clock forward to UTC +1 from the last Sunday in March until the last Sunday in October.
During this period, clocks are set one hour ahead, allowing for longer daylight in the evenings.
